Output 05956fc757dd9d2f86b4f92ee40dce7d6c37e8f77340c2cd83ed0a885b5316f2:31

value
31006387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7107ffe3a8cd7a6d1075d60dc732f489f484cd9 OP_EQUAL
address
MS3iU3RmXyXWAs6bc8CKZ25gjFtuP5JR1A
transaction
05956fc757dd9d2f86b4f92ee40dce7d6c37e8f77340c2cd83ed0a885b5316f2
spent
true